Mindoro Beach is a popular destination located a short 15-minute ride from Vigan. The beach is known for its unique grayish-green sand and clean shore. The sand is fine and dark, providing a unique contrast to the clear waters of the West Philippine Sea. The beach is also a local fishing spot, adding to its charm.
One of the main attractions of Mindoro Beach is its beautiful sunset views, as it faces the West Philippine Sea. As dusk approaches, the beach draws more visitors, both locals and tourists alike. The waves at the beach are typically insignificant, making it a safe and enjoyable place for swimming. The beach is also shallow, making it suitable for swimmers of all levels.
Mindoro Beach offers several amenities for visitors. There are cottages where people can rest and enjoy the fresh air. Nearby, there are shops selling beverages and light snacks. The beach also features concrete breakwaters that absorb strong waves before they reach the shore, adding an extra layer of safety for swimmers. The presence of police outposts provides an additional sense of security for visitors.
The beach is free to enter and is an ideal side trip for those visiting Vigan. Whether you want to swim, relax, or simply enjoy nature, Mindoro Beach offers a refreshing experience.
